本文以改善高职院校电类专业的专业基础课程教学效果,提高教学效率为目的。探索基于任务驱动的电类专业基础课程教学设计方案。以《电子技术与项目训练》课程的教学实践为例,提出了一套适合高职院校电类专业的专业基础课程教学设计思路,为今后课程改革方向提供一定的参考。
